Can “Whiplash” Happen at Low Speeds? “Whiplash” is commonly defined as “an acceleration–deceleration mechanism of energy transfer to the neck. ... Read More
Emotional Impact of Scoliosis According to a poll recently done by the American Psychiatry Association, nearly 40 million American Adults ... Read More